AN Urmston schoolboy was a surprise name on the substitutes bench for Manchester United's Premier League tie with West Brom on Saturday.

Cameron Borthwick-Jackson was an ex-pupil at St Anthony's Catholic College in Urmston and came off the bench with 14 minutes remaining to make his debut for the Old Trafford side.

Borthwick-Jackson was a member of United's 2014 Milk Cup-winning squad in Northern Ireland and earned his place due to his versatility.

"Cameron has been excellent really this season," United U21s coach Warren Joyce said.

"He has gone from strength to strength."
